How to Make Grilled Hot Dogs for 4th of July

Follow these simple steps to prepare this delicious Grilled Hot Dogs for 4th of July:

Step 1: Preheat the Grill

Get your grill nice and hot! Preheat it to medium-high heat (about 400°F/200°C) so that when those hot dogs hit the grates, they get that perfect sear.

Step 2: Prepare Your Hot Dogs

While the grill is heating up, take your hot dogs out and poke a few holes in them with a fork. This step prevents them from bursting while grilling (trust me, no one wants exploding hot dogs).

Step 3: Grill Those Bad Boys

Once your grill is ready, place the hot dogs on it. Grill them for about 6-8 minutes until they are nicely charred and heated through. Don’t forget to turn them occasionally for an even cook!

Step 4: Toast the Buns

In the last few minutes of grilling your hot dogs, toss the buns on the grill as well. Toast them lightly until golden—this step adds an irresistible crunch!

Step 5: Assemble Your Masterpiece

Now comes the fun part! Place the grilled hot dogs in their toasted buns and pile on your favorite condiments and toppings. Go wild!

Step 6: Serve Up A Feast

Transfer your assembled grilled hot dogs to a platter. Serve with extra napkins because let’s be honest—you’re gonna need ‘em!

Grilled Hot Dogs for 4th of July

5 Stars 4 Stars 3 Stars 2 Stars 1 Star No reviews
  • Author: Pamela
  • Prep Time: 10 minutes
  • Cook Time: 10 minutes
  • Total Time: 20 minutes
  • Yield: Serves 4
  • Category: Main
  • Method: Grilling
  • Cuisine: American
Print Recipe
Pin Recipe

Description

Grilled hot dogs are the ultimate 4th of July treat, bringing summer flavors to your backyard barbecue. Picture juicy, perfectly charred hot dogs nestled in soft, toasted buns and topped with your favorite condiments. This easy recipe allows for endless customization to satisfy every guest’s palate. Get ready to impress your friends and family with this classic American dish that embodies the spirit of Independence Day!


Ingredients

Scale
  • 4 hot dogs (beef, turkey, or plant-based)
  • 4 sturdy hot dog buns
  • 2 tbsp ketchup
  • 2 tbsp mustard
  • 1/4 cup chopped onions
  • 1/2 cup shredded cheese (optional)
  • 1/4 cup pico de gallo (optional)

Instructions

  1. Preheat the grill to medium-high heat (400°F/200°C).
  2. Poke holes in each hot dog to prevent bursting while grilling.
  3. Grill the hot dogs for 6-8 minutes, turning occasionally until charred.
  4. Toast the buns on the grill during the last few minutes until lightly golden.
  5. Assemble by placing grilled hot dogs in buns and adding desired toppings.
  6. Serve immediately on a platter.


Nutrition

  • Serving Size: 1 grilled hot dog with bun (150g)
  • Calories: 290
  • Sugar: 3g
  • Sodium: 600mg
  • Fat: 16g
  • Saturated Fat: 6g
  • Unsaturated Fat: 10g
  • Trans Fat: 0g
  • Carbohydrates: 30g
  • Fiber: 1g
  • Protein: 10g
  • Cholesterol: 40mg
